Japan has witnessed a remarkable reduction in traffic accidents, and the credit goes to an unexpected source – hand-painted traffic signs. In a unique approach to road safety, these artfully designed signs have captured the attention of drivers and significantly contributed to lowering the incidence of accidents on Japanese roads.

The hand-painted signs, featuring vibrant colors and creative designs, serve as more than just traffic directives. They act as attention-grabbing visual cues, enhancing driver awareness and fostering a safer driving environment. The initiative aims to break through the monotony of traditional signage, ensuring that crucial information is not only conveyed effectively but also leaves a lasting impression on motorists.

Local authorities and artists collaborated on this innovative project, strategically placing these artistic signs at key locations prone to accidents. The results have been promising, with a notable decrease in traffic incidents reported in areas adorned with these unique road markers.

Drivers and pedestrians alike have responded positively to the unconventional approach, appreciating the blend of functionality and aesthetics. The success of this initiative highlights the potential of creative solutions in addressing societal challenges, even in unexpected domains such as traffic safety.

As japan continues to prioritize innovative measures for enhancing road safety, the hand-painted traffic signs stand as a testament to the positive impact that thoughtful design can have on public behavior and, ultimately, the well-being of communities.
